2017-04-03 7 views
1

私は次のようにinformaticaに整数データ型のソースファイルを持っています。 JoiningDate:20161201 整数をデータ型に変換して、データをnetezzaターゲット表にロードする必要があります。この形式の日付データ型を20161201のnetezzaで使用することは可能ですか?informaticaのデータ型書式

ターゲット表の日付データ型にこの値20161201が必要です。ターゲットに日付データ型を使用している場合は、2016/12/01 00:00:00となります。

答えて

0

あなたの質問は私には100%明確ではありません。

1)あなたはターゲットに「負荷」にデータをnzloadを使用して、あなただけはネティーザに供給されているフラットファイルを書き込むためのPowerCenterを使用していますか?

2)powercenterマッピング/セッションでテーブルターゲットに直接書き込んでいますか?今の

:私は2)

A)を仮定しますが、まったく同じNetezzaのテーブル内とのPowerCenterのターゲットでデータ型とすべての列の順序はありますか? b)informaticaの "integer"日付をINTからDATE/TIMEデータ型に変換するにはどうすればよいですか? (明示的であるあなたが変換しない場合、それは:)おそらくあなたの問題です)

0

トライTO_DATE(JoiningDate 'YYYYMMDD')

+1

スタックオーバーフローへようこそ!このコードスニペットは歓迎されていますが、いくつかの助けを提供するかもしれませんが、*どうやって質問に対処するのかは、説明があれば大幅に改善されます(// meta.stackexchange.com/q/114762)。それがなければ、あなたの答えははるかに教育的価値が低くなります。あなたが今質問している人だけでなく、将来読者の質問に答えていることを忘れないでください!説明を追加するためにあなたの答えを[編集]し、どんな制限と前提が適用されるかを示してください。 –